Father of American music In my opinion, Claude Debussy is the father of American music. In this review I'm referring to his piano music from about 1903 to 1907. Most popular classical music written by American composers that is upheld in America, was not written by composers who came from the "traditional classical period" of Europe. Rather as our own history and culture begins about 100 years ago with classical and jazz compositions, Debussy brand of world music (European, Asian and African influences) was right on time for the American society to relate to. And hence, American music was founded through these diversities and Debussy was the famous composer of the time who our composers looked to.
Debussy's main influences for his piano music between 1903 and 1907 (his best works) are influenced by French society composers (Chopin, late Litz, neither French in heritage but rather in spirit), Asian music (in particular pentatonic "sounding" gamelan music - which would later influences jazz and the blues scale), Gregorian Chants (for it's plaintive style, modal and tonic gravity) and African music (for it's meditative rhythms).
The CD represents some of Debussy's best competitions, only leaving some obscure solo pieces and an earlier book of "Images' sometimes referred to as "oubliees". There is an excellent recording on the Nonesuch label with this great "forgotten" work performed by Paul Jacobs. I should also mention that many consider Arturo Benedetti Michelangeli to be perhaps the greatest Debussy interpreter.
